I just returned from a week long cruise. The casino on the ship didn't have half dollar slots..but they did have lots of nickel machines. Just put a $20 bill in and then cash out...you don't even have to play. I found 87 pre 1960 nickels doing this...including a silver war nickel.

I search casinos exclusively and have incredible luck. I never owned a silver war nickel until I started searching casinos 20 years ago and now have over 300. I want to kick myself for not searching half dollar rolls until recently.

You gotta move fast because a lot of casinos are converting to coinless machines. My casino searching days are numbered? :'(

Sounds like a great place to hunt for silver! Most of the casinos I go to use coins. You could buy rolls of quarters and dimes, then bust them open into those casino cups, check for silver, then take them back to the cage, cash them in, and get some more.
No re-rolling, no fee's, and you can go through the whole supply while enjoying a free drink lol. The only problem I would see is the urge to gamble.
